The soil in an ecosystem has high levels of nitrogen due to the burning of fossil fuels in a nearby industrial area. Scientists predict

that these high nitrogen levels will cause a decrease in the rate decomposition in the ecosystem over time. Why will this most
likely cause a decrease in the carrying capacity of the ecosystem?

2 Answers

13 votes

Answer:b. The ecosystem will be unable to efficiently recycle the remains of dead organisms
